The key to informed practice and intervention in social work lies in building and establishing a base that comprises of deliberations on theory, positions and movements. They play a key role in taking studied positions and cultivated interventions that then reflect the epistemic maturity of the profession mirroring onto praxis. This book attempts to bring together on one platform theories, positions and movements that influence the episteme of social work. The commencing point is the domain of social theorising from positivism to postmodernism. This is followed by positions offered by religion and faith and the deliberations in that realm. The third aspect is the modern and postcolonial realm falling within which are discussions on social reform, Gandhian thought and nationalism as also deliberations on social justice and human rights. Movements entail subaltern voices and praxis commencing with Dalit and tribal movements, transnational and indigenous discourses in the women s movement, queer theorisations and movements of alternative sexuality, discourses on ecology and disability. Finally, the attempt is to link discussions on theory, positions, movements and social work perspectives ranging from charity to critical practice. The book thus presents a comprehensive view of social theorisation, positions and movements that interface with social work and lend to a consolidation of perspectives. It would serve as reference material for graduate students in social work.

Actors in social transformation: deliberating on a model. References. Index. This book examines the role of Hindu-inspired Faith Movements (HIFMs) as actors in social transformation. HIFMs have emerged as important actors in the modern civil society. In the contemporary Indian neo-liberal and postmodern scenario, HIFMs realize themselves by making public assertions through service or seva. Four pillars of HIFMs contemporary presence are Gurus, sociality, hegemony and social transformation. Gurus, who spearhead these movements, create a matrix of possible meanings in their public discourses. This allows their followers to pick up the required ingredients that aid transformation. Sociality, the tangible part of which is social service, is essentially seen as one core strategy of proliferation across HIFMs. Social service of the HIFMs spans and accommodates several domains. Service is further qualified by memories of the guru or his/her expansive agency. Remembrance of the Guru or his/her expansive agency. Remembrance of the guru is a catalyst for social action and demonstrates a preference for principles such as human rights, peace and justice, which the gurus are believed to embody. Hegemony is reflected in the fact that HIFMs social service ominously foreshadows the Hindutva doctrine. HIFMs essentially propose a model of Hindu inspired social transformation, which proposes a redeeming intervention of faith building into and transforming the civil society. (jacket).

Druck auf Anfrage Neuware - Printed after ordering - This book examines the role of Hindu-inspired faith movements (HIFMs) in contemporary India as actors in social transformation. It further situates these movements in the context of the global political economy where such movements cross national boundaries to locate believers among the Hindu diaspora and others.In contemporary neoliberal India, HIFMs have become important actors, and they realize themselves by making public assertions through service. The four pillars of the contemporary presence of such movements are: gurus, sociality, hegemony and social transformation. Gurus, who spearhead these movements, create a matrix of possible meanings in their public discourses which their followers pick up to create messages of personal and social change. Socialityis a core strategy of proliferation across such movements and implies social service, which is qualified by memories of the guru and what they are believed to embody. Hegemonyis reflected in the fact that social service in such movements often ominously imbibes right-wing or far-right Hinduism. They propose a model of Hindu-inspired social transformation, involving faith building into and transforming the civil society. The book discusses in a nuanced way several Hindu-inspired faith movements of various hues which have made national and international impact.This topical book is of interest to students and researchers in the fields of sociology, anthropology, social work, and social psychology, with a special interest in the study of religious movements.

This item is printed on demand - it takes 3-4 days longer - Neuware -Spiritual Ecology and Ecotheology: This work is based on a study of four contemporary Indic organisations within the purview of Hinduism in terms of their perspectives on ecological consciousness, ecological initiatives and micro and macro implications of perspectives and initiatives. The basic purpose is to see how spiritual and religious consciousness influences ecological consciousness. The pragmatic value of the exploration lies in providing a new insight to ecological consciousness (of the influence of religious and spiritual consciousness within the purview of Hinduism on ecological consciousness) in the wake of the current ecological crisis. The core finding is that sacralisation of nature is viewed as an ecologically viable proposition to combat the present day ecological crisis - sacralisation as instrumental in nature preservation, also bringing in dimensions of embedded morality in human nature relationships, soul-cosmos relations as revealing the individual being as the microcosm of the macrocosmic universe and the universe as a manifestation of the Ultimate Reality. 208 pp. Englisch.

This monograph is based on a study of 906 ageing respondents in Mumbai, India, on their constructions of meaning of spirituality, spiritual beliefs, practices, experiences, involvement in spiritual organisations and perceived influences of spirituality on various dimensions of the ageing process. Spirituality was perceived to provide support, aid relationship building and maintenance, facilitate coping with stress and ideas and issues in relation to death and dying. Further it was also viewed as enabling deconstruction of popular notions of ageing, provide a pathway to soul liberation and detachment/ disengagement as a precursor to well being in late life. The study submits that the findings have implications for epistemology of social gerontology in terms of insertions of spirituality facets and for praxis in terms of cognisance of the quintessentiality of spiritually inclined social work practice with ageing individuals. 180 pp. Englisch.
